{"repo":"Vanilagy/mediabunny","free":true,"listed":false,"github":"https://github.com/Vanilagy/mediabunny","clone":"git clone https://github.com/Vanilagy/mediabunny.git","description":"Pure TypeScript media toolkit for reading, writing, and converting video and audio files, directly in the browser.","language":"TypeScript","stars":6932,"topics":["audio","decoding","demuxing","encoding","media","mp3","mp4","muxing","ogg","video"],"license":"MPL-2.0","category":"media-processing","readme_excerpt":"Mediabunny - JavaScript media toolkit Mediabunny is a JavaScript library for reading, writing, and converting media (like MP4, WebM, MP3, HLS), directly in the browser. It aims to be a complete toolkit for high-performance media operations on the web. It's written from scratch in pure TypeScript, has zero dependencies, is very performant, and is extremely tree-shakable, meaning you only include what you use. You can think of it a bit like FFmpeg, but built from the ground up for the web.
